First Infraction Penalties
When facing your very first DWI fee, what charges should you anticipate? You could deal with a range of consequences, beginning with penalties that can rise to $2,000.
In addition to financial penalties, you might additionally handle a permit suspension, generally lasting from 90 days to a year, depending upon your state's regulations.
Community service is an additional most likely demand; you might need to finish an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.
If you're convicted, you might also need to participate in a DWI education and learning program, which can involve a significant time commitment.
In some cases, you may even be required to install an ignition interlock tool in your automobile, which avoids you from driving if you've been drinking.
Jail time is an opportunity, however it's usually less than a year for a very first violation, especially if there are no aggravating variables like an accident or high blood alcohol material.

Repeat Infraction Fines
Encountering a repeat DWI fee can lead to dramatically harsher charges than an initial violation. If you're captured driving while intoxicated once more, you could deal with boosted penalties, longer permit suspensions, or perhaps obligatory jail time. The legal system tends to view repeat culprits as a better danger to public safety, so your consequences will certainly reflect that.
For your 2nd DWI, charges often double. You could be checking out penalties varying from $1,000 to $5,000, depending upon your state. In addition, you may face a minimum certificate suspension of one year or more.
If this is your third offense or greater, the charges escalate also further. You may be sentenced to several months in jail, and some territories may also require you to mount an ignition interlock device in your automobile.
Furthermore, many states execute required alcohol education and learning or therapy programs for repeat offenders, contributing to the general burden.

Long-term Consequences
Lasting repercussions of a drunk driving cost can influence various elements of your life for years to find.
When you've been convicted, you might encounter greater insurance premiums and even problem acquiring cars and truck insurance coverage at all. Insurer often see you as a greater threat, which can bring about substantial financial stress.
